Bruno Olivieri is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Electrical and Electronic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Bruno Olivieri has authored 35 papers receiving a total of 1.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 23 papers in Materials Chemistry, 19 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and 6 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ering. Recurrent topics in Bruno Olivieri’s work include Graphene research and applications (15 papers), Topological Materials and Phenomena (9 papers) and ZnO doping and properties (6 papers). Bruno Olivieri is often cited by papers focused on Graphene research and applications (15 papers), Topological Materials and Phenomena (9 papers) and ZnO doping and properties (6 papers). Bruno Olivieri collaborates with scholars based in Italy, France and Germany. Bruno Olivieri's co-authors include Paola De Padova, G. Le Lay, C. Quaresima, C. Ottaviani, P. Perfetti, B. Aufray, Hamid Oughaddou, Polina M. Sheverdyaeva, Paolo Moras and C. Carbone and has published in prestigious journals such as Nano Letters, Journal of Geophysical Research Atmospheres and Applied Physics Letters.
